Output e04cb5c93bcbe54ad8f5a551c5411105b0f67bc67fa3bcc36bd4744f9e16c113:65

value
781713
script pubkey
OP_0 OP_PUSHBYTES_20 b3a44b149a2c0322ddd53cd1ba112d259e2107ec
address
bc1qkwjyk9y69spj9hw48ngm5yfdyk0zzplvttk50h
transaction
e04cb5c93bcbe54ad8f5a551c5411105b0f67bc67fa3bcc36bd4744f9e16c113
confirmations
48183
spent
true